Which of the following factors influences the structure of an
organization?

a.Age of the building
b.Brand of computer system
c.Number of employees
d.Square footage of the facility
Ans: c.Number of employees

Within nursing practice, the use of advanced practice roles is an
example of:

a.cross-training.
b.departmentalization.
c.fragmentation.
d.specialization.
Ans: d.specialization.

The nursing chief executive officer (CEO) works in a major
rehabilitation and subacute facility network. Her span of control
refers to the number of:

a.miles in which the network resides.
b.ancillary staff accountable to her.
c.nurses and non-nurses reporting to her.
d.inpatients that the facilities service.
Ans: c.nurses and non-nurses reporting to her.

A nurse manager is responsible for a unit consisting of 40 nurses
who report to two clinical supervisors. In addition, there are 10

The ways in which work is divided and coordinated among
members and the resulting network of relationships, roles, and
work groups is the:

a.organization.
b.organizational social structure.
c.structure.
d.formal relationship.


© 2025 All rights reserved

, 4 | Page

Ans: b.organizational social structure.

According to the _____ organizational approach, organizations are
logical and predictable with identifiable and scientifically
measurable characteristics that can be predicted, observed, or
manipulated.

a.objective
b.subjective
c.postmodern
d.realistic
Ans: a.objective

Which organizational theory emphasized the informal aspects of
organization social structure and was influenced by the Hawthorne
experiments?

a.Bureaucratic theory
b.Scientific management school
c.Classical management theory
d.Human relations school
Ans: d.Human relations school

The division of work by occupation or function is a form of:

a.specialization.
b.interdependence.
c.uncertainty.
d.technology.
Ans: a.specialization.
